Brindza Hits High Note in Music City

Kyle Brindza’s 32-yard field goal as time expired gave Notre Dame a well-earned 31-28 upset victory over the LSU Tigers in the Music City Bowl on Tuesday. Three Yards and a Cloud of Controversy

Notre Dame’s heroic attempt at a game-winning drive in the final seconds came up empty when an apparent touchdown by Corey Robinson was negated by offensive pass interference, and the Irish fell by 31-27 to Florida State in a hard fought contest on Saturday night.
